Introducing The Shelborne by Proper, a holistic restoration of the iconic Miami beachfront hotel. This extensive renovation preserves the landmark’s 1940 art deco distinction and authentic charm while modernizing interiors from top to bottom — all embracing the rich heritage originally crafted by Morris Lapidus and Igor Polevitzky, two of the most celebrated Art Deco architects of the mid-twentieth century.


The Shelborne introduces four vibrant new food & beverage destinations to the neighborhood, each suited for warm weather dining, with an all-day signature restaurant, a lobby bar- lounge, and curated cafe. Resort amenities include a spacious pool and lush garden lounge, indoor-outdoor cabanas, sundeck terrace, state-of-the-art fitness center, dedicated access to a private beach club, and more than 15,000 square feet of indoor-outdoor meeting & event space.


Position Overview

The Assistant Director of Sales will have a strong background in group sales within the boutique or luxury hotel sector. You will be responsible for driving revenue, managing relationships with key accounts, and supporting the Director of Sales & Marketing in achieving the hotel's financial objectives. As a key member of our leadership team, you will help shape and implement sales strategies that enhance the guest experience while maximizing occupancy and event bookings.


Key Responsibilities:

  • Assist the Director of Sales & Marketing in developing and executing comprehensive sales strategies to increase group and corporate bookings
  • Manage key client accounts, nurturing relationships to drive repeat business and referrals
  • Proactively identify new business opportunities in the group sales sectors, maintaining a strong pipeline of prospects
  • Lead group sales presentations, contract negotiations and on-site tours for potential clients
  • Collaborate closely with The Shelborne's event planning and operations teams to ensure seamless event execution and guest satisfaction
  • Analyze sales trends and market data to forecast revenue and adjust strategies accordingly
  • Maintain an up-to-date knowledge of market trends, competitor activity and industry developments
  • Support the Director of Sales & Marketing in preparing regular sales reports, budget analysis and forecasting
  • Attend industry events, networking functions and trade shows to represent the hotel and build relationships


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in hospitality management, business or a related field preferred
  • 3-5 years of experience in group sales or related roles in luxury or boutique hotels
  • Proven track record of meeting or exceeding sales targets
  • Strong negotiation and relationship-building skills
